Last Updated at 11 October 2024UMS Saifulah Tola Maldah, a Government Primary School in Bihar, India
UMS Saifulah Tola Maldah is a government-run primary school located in the rural Jokihat block of Araria district, Bihar, India. Established in 1965, this co-educational institution offers classes from 1st to 8th standard, providing education to children in the local community. The school's management falls under the Department of Education, signifying its commitment to public education.
The school building, though partially walled, houses 11 classrooms, ensuring ample space for instruction. A dedicated room is provided for the headmaster/teacher, facilitating administrative functions and effective communication. The school's resources include a library, containing 70 books, and functional boys' and girls' toilets, each totaling one. Hand pumps provide a reliable source of drinking water for students and staff. Accessibility is ensured with ramps available for disabled children. While the school doesn't currently have electricity or a playground, its commitment to education remains paramount.
The curriculum follows a Hindi medium of instruction, aligning with the local language and making learning accessible for the majority of students. The teaching staff comprises 12 teachers, with 9 male teachers and 3 female teachers. This balanced staffing ensures comprehensive student support. The school provides midday meals, prepared and served on the premises, ensuring that students receive proper nourishment to support their learning.
The school’s academic structure follows a primary with upper primary model (classes 1-8). The school does not have a pre-primary section. It is noteworthy that the school is not a residential facility. It operates with the assistance of a single head teacher, Shresh Nandan Jha, who guides and supports the school's activities.
